About

Hongfeng Pan is a leading colorectal surgeon whose research focuses on advancing minimally invasive surgical techniques for rectal cancer, particularly through robotic and laparoscopic approaches. His major contributions center on optimizing surgical outcomes for patients with low rectal cancer, especially those who have undergone neo-adjuvant therapy. In his highly cited 2025 study, Pan conducted a large-volume single-center comparison of laparoscopic versus robot-assisted surgery for rectal cancer after neo-adjuvant treatment, providing critical insights into short- and long-term outcomes—a topic previously lacking clarity. His 2024 work on robotic intersphincteric resection for low rectal cancer employed cumulative sum analysis to define the learning curve for this complex procedure, offering a roadmap for surgeons adopting robotic techniques. With 9 and 6 citations respectively, these papers have already shaped clinical decision-making and training protocols. Pan’s research bridges the gap between technological innovation and practical surgical application, making him a key figure in the evolution of robotic colorectal surgery and a valuable resource for trainees and peers seeking evidence-based guidance.
